بررسی معماری های مبتنی برCPU و GPU برای بازی های رایانه ای و واقعیت مجازی

سال انتشار: 1396
نوع سند: مقاله کنفرانسی
زبان: فارسی
مشاهده: 1,083

فایل این مقاله در 19 صفحه با فرمت PDF قابل دریافت می باشد

استخراج به نرم افزارهای پژوهشی:

لینک ثابت به این مقاله:

شناسه ملی سند علمی:

DGRCONF01_067

تاریخ نمایه سازی: 7 اسفند 1396

چکیده مقاله:

امروزه کارایی سیستمهای کامپیوتری برای انجام کارهای مختلف بسیار حایز اهمیت است. یکی از مهمترین وسایل الکترونیکی، گوشیهای هوشمند و تبلتها است. کارایی این وسایل برای تمامی کاربران به منظور انجام کارهای خود و اجرای برنامه های کاربردی ازجمله بازیهای رایانه ای بسیار بااهمیت است. اجرای برنامه های با پردازش سنگین همچون بازیهای رایانه ای، با توجه به امکانات الزم ازجمله توان پردازش تصویرسازی هر چه بهتر، نیازمند بستر سخت افزاری قدرتمند است. با توجه به اندازه این وسایل، استفاده از ابزار قوی سخت افزاری در درون آنها امکان پذیر نیست. در این شرایط برای افزایش بازدهی سیستم، طراحی معماری صحیح میتواند راه گشا باشد. این شرایط برای کنسولهای بازی نیز صادق است و تمامی شرکتهای سازنده این وسایل به دنبال راهی برای بهبود کیفیت تصویرسازی و هر چه روانتر اجراشدن این برنامهها بر روی سیستمهای خود هستند. با توجه به سیستمهای طراحی شده در چند سال اخیر، عملکرد GPUها بسیار بااهمیت تر از گذشته شده است. موضوع جدیدی که در معماری گوشیهای هوشمند وجود دارد، کارکرد تعاملی CPU و GPU تحت عنوان APU است. این تعامل، بهبود چشمگیری در بازدهی این سیستمها داشته است، اما کارایی آنها هنوز به حداکثر نرسیده است. برای این منظور در این گزارش نحوه تعامل CPU و GPU در تراشههای مختلف مربوط به حوزه بازیهای رایانهای بررسی شده است. همچنین مشکالت موجود بر سر راه تعامل هر چه بهتر و نیز راه حلهایی برای برطرف کردن این مشکلات پیشنهادشده است. ارایه راهحلهایی از قبیل زمان بندی وظیفه ها و معماری جدید برای تعامل CPU و GPU میتواند کارگشا باشد.

کلیدواژه ها:

تعامل CPU و GPU ، بهبود کارایی APU ، معماری های مبتنی بر CPU ، معماری های مبتنی بر GPU

نویسندگان

مجتبی جلال نژاد

کارشناس ارشد مهندسی کامپیوتر ،گرایش معماری سیستمهای کامپیوتری، دانشگاه علم و صنعت ایران

عرفان قنادتوکلی

کارشناس ارشد مهندسی کامپیوتر ، گرایش نرمافزار، دانشگاه علم و صنعت ایران

محسن سریانی

دانشیار مهندسی کامپیوتر گروه معماری سیستمهای کامپیوتری و هوش مصنوعی، دانشگاه علم و صنعت ایران

بهروز مینایی بیدگلی

دانشیار مهندسی کامپیوتر، گروه نرمافزار و هوش مصنوعی، دانشگاه علم و صنعت ایران